The lightest scooters weigh as little as 60 pounds, however longer-range mobility scooters can be much larger. Large scooters can be hard to get in and out of vehicles.


One of the most cost effective electrical mobility devices price in between $1,000 and $1,500. A portion of this expense might be covered by Medicare and/or Medicaid for eligible people. Seniors that intend to tailor the design of their electrical wheelchair or that desire something specifically lightweight/fast can expect to pay even more for this.

On the other hand, electrical wheelchairs are designed for seniors that need help to move in your home. The additional seat extra padding and back support mean they're more comfy for long term usage, and the smaller transforming span means the customer can navigate limited corridors or areas packed with furnishings much more easily. Electric wheelchairs can be made use of outdoors, but they're normally slower than wheelchair scooters and often have a shorter range.

The smaller boot mobility scooters have a series of around 10-15 miles depending upon the model. The batteries can often be upgraded to give better performance, or an added battery pack can be continued the mobility scooter to efficiently double the array of the electrical mobility scooter. The rate of the mobility scooter is figured out by the amount of pressure placed on the forward/ reverse bar.


EwheelsGreen Transporter
When obtaining used to the electric scooter, it might be much better to make use of a reduced rate setup. On the roadway lawful flexibility scooters, there is normally a switch which decreases the optimal rate from 8mph to 4mph, which after that allows the scooter to be made use of legitimately on a sidewalk. To decrease, the user simply needs to launch the forward or reverse bar, which after that brings the flexibility scooter to a quit.


An emergency bicycle design brake is fitted to some models for additional safety and safety. Course 3, 8mph flexibility scooters are roadway lawful, and so can travel on the freeway. By legislation, these need to be fitted with full lights and signs. The mobility scooters usually have an adjustable and detachable seat. Depending on the design of electrical scooter, the seat may be updated to a larger, a lot more comfortable, extra encouraging seat.




Handicapped scooters have a freewheel mode, which allows the scooter to be relocated, without the scooter being switched on. This makes saving and moving your electrical scooter simpler, and can aid when the batteries are charging, and it needs relocating. Scooters are steered using the tiller, which resembles a bicycle or motorbike handlebar.
